Judge's Kick Ass Chicken Wraps

Easy Peasy, especially if you have some already cooked chicken

Makes 2 Wraps

2 Ten Inch (or full size) flour tortillas
4 pieces of chicken tenders, grilled, fried, your preference
1/2 cup of lettuce, carrots, cabbage, whatever you like in a salad
4 tablespoons of light ranch dressing ( can adjust to taste )
4 ounces of grated cheese, your preference.  I use a cheddar jack mix.
Sprinkling of Mrs. Dash Soutwest seasoning for a bit of heat.

Make sure the chicken is hot, either by microwaving or fresh cooked.

Warm your tortillas for about 3 seconds, until they're nice and pliable.  Lay them on a flat surface.  Place two chicken tenders end to end on the wrap.  Sprinkle the cheese on the chicken, and let it melt if you want (chicken should be hot enough to melt it slightly.  Sprinkle the Mrs. Dash on top of the cheese.  Lay down your salad mix on top of the  chicken and cheese.  Pour whatever dressing you want on top of the salad. Do not over load it, otherwise, you can't fold it.

Roll up the back end so it just covers the chicken. Fold the sides over so they encase the chicken in a little box, then roll the whole package over.  If you did it right, you should have a bit of overlap of the tortilla left.  Turn the seam side down, cut in half and enjoy.
